NAMI LAKE NONA is a distinguished dining establishment located discreetly at the Lake Nona Wave Hotel, adjacent to the renowned Lake Nona Sculpture Garden. This restaurant is noted for its exclusive and intimate 10-seat omakase counter, where guests can experience a contemporary twist on the traditional chef-curated Japanese dining experience. The interior also features an energetic cocktail bar and dining room, which provide varied culinary experiences through thoughtfully prepared menus. These menus masterfully balance precise technique with playful nuances, showcasing Nami's innovative interpretation of Japanese ingredients and flavors. Job Duties

  • Create and update the wine list in coordination with chefs and the Food and Beverage Manager
  • recommend food and wine pairings
  • advise guests on wines based on their personal tastes and food choices
  • inform guests about different varieties of wines and prices
  • ensure wines are served at the right temperature and within the proper glassware
  • store open bottles properly to maintain strong taste
  • manage wine cellar and ensure it's fully-stocked
  • train wait staff on available wines
  • negotiate purchase prices with vendors
  • organize wine tasting days or wine of the month events
  • ask guests for ID to verify legal drinking age
  • comply with all health and safety regulations
